For Office Desktop Programs:

  • Improved Outlook Calendaring Reliability
  • Improved Outlook Performance
  • Enabling Object Model support for Charts in PowerPoint and Word
  • Improved cryptographic functionality by supporting all cryptographic algorithms offered by the operating system
  • Improved functionality in Excel’s charting mechanism
  • Ability to ungroup Smart Art graphics (and as a result, the ability to add animations to them in PowerPoint)
  • Ability for Visio to export UML models to an XML file compliant with the XMI standard
  • Tool that enables the uninstall of Office client Service Packs

For Servers:

  • Performance and manageability improvements to variations in Enterprise Content Management (ECM) including STSADM commands for repairing links between source and target pages
  • Improvements around processing status approvals from Office Project Web Access into Office Project Professional 2007
  • Improvements to read-only content databases and index rebuild timer jobs in Windows SharePoint Services 3.0

SP Improvement

Product(s)

Description

Built-in PDF/XPS Support

Access, Excel, PowerPoint, Publisher, Visio, Word

PDF/XPS support is built into these Office applications with SP2. Users no longer need to download the add-in separately.

Excel charting

Excel

Service Pack 2 fixes many issues in Excel 2007’s charting mechanism.

ODF Support

Excel, PowerPoint, Word

Adds support for opening, editing, and saving documents in the Open Document Format for Word, Excel, and PowerPoint.  These three of these applications now allow users to save files as OpenDocument Text (*.odt), OpenDocument Spreadsheet (*.ods), and OpenDocument Presentations (*.odp).

Service Pack Uninstall

Office Client

SP2 will be uninstallable via a command line tool that is downloadable separately.  This addresses a long-standing customer request that Office SP's be uninstallable rather than requiring users to uninstall and reinstall all of Office.

Improve Performance and Responsiveness

Outlook

Improved Responsiveness due to decreased I/O demands when working with a PST/OST file - especially helpful on slower hard drives or first generation Solid State Drives (SSDs).
Improved Boot and Shutdown times, and more reliable Shutdown.
Improved Folder Switch times.
More responsive loading of emails.
Synchronization improvements in IMAP.

Calendar Reliability Improvements

Outlook

Synchronization improvements between organizer and attendee appointments.
Improved reminder dismissal reliability.
Improved appointment saving reliability.
Corrected certain cases where the attendees did not receive appointment updates.
Corrected some cases where attendees could be mistakenly added or removed.
Fixed cases where recipients were being duplicated in appointments.

General Improvements

Outlook

Reduced the possibility of RSS feed items duplication.
Fixed crashes when opening IRM protected mail items.
Added support for Print options page selection.
Eliminated a number of top Outlook crashes. 
Implemented HAB schema change to support Exchange 14
